Studies on derivatives of bat chelates labelled with 67Ga, 113mIn and 201Ti: Pt. 2

Description
The net charges of the new potential myocardial imaging chelates M-BAT-TE and M-BAT-HM (M =Ca3+, In3+, Tl3+) were determined by means of the ion exchange resin method. The net charges of these six chelates were all identified as + 1. In determining stability constants the pH electric potential method was used. The experimental results show that the magnitudes of the stability constants are in such an order: Tl-HM>In-HM>Ca-HM; Tl-TE>Ga-TE. This order is identical to the order of the heart uptake in mice of these chelates
